#5f9968 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#5f9968 is composed of 37.3% red, 60% green and 40.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 37.9% cyan, 0% magenta, 32% yellow and 40% black. It has a hue angle of 129.3 degrees, a saturation of 23.4% and a lightness of 48.6%. #5f9968 color hex could be obtained by blending #beffd0 with #003300. Closest websafe color is: #669966.

#5f9968 color description : Mostly desaturated dark lime green.

#5f9968 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#5f9968 has RGB values of R:95, G:153, B:104 and CMYK values of C:0.38, M:0, Y:0.32, K:0.4. Its decimal value is 6265192.

Shades and Tints of #5f9968

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#050805 is the darkest color, while #fbfcfb is the lightest one.

Tones of #5f9968

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#7c7c7c is the less saturated color, while #09ef2d is the most saturated one.
